Hatola Population - Almora, Uttarakhand

Hatola is a medium size village located in Almora Tehsil of Almora district, Uttarakhand with total 61 families residing. The Hatola village has population of 268 of which 128 are males while 140 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Hatola village population of children with age 0-6 is 43 which makes up 16.04 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Hatola village is 1094 which is higher than Uttarakhand state average of 963. Child Sex Ratio for the Hatola as per census is 483, lower than Uttarakhand average of 890.

Hatola village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ttarakh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Hatola village was 64.00 % compared to 78.82 % of Uttarakhand. In Hatola Male literacy stands at 81.82 % while female literacy rate was 50.00 %.

Caste Factor

Hatola village of Almora has substantial population of Schedule Caste.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 30.22 % of total population in Hatola village. The village Hatola curr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Hatola village out of total population, 113 were engaged in work activities. 100.00 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 0.00 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 113 workers engaged in Main Work, 103 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
